Plaintiffs' 761 — O.J. Simpson's June 15-Dated “To Whom It May Concern” Letter

O.J. Simpson's four-page handwritten “To Whom It May Concern” letter, dated June 15, 1994 but described as written on the morning of June 17 and read publicly by Robert Kardashian that day. Introduced as Plaintiffs' 761, it was characterized by participants as a suicide note or potential suicide note and included Simpson's description of himself as a “battered spouse” or “battered one.”
